Giacomo's concerti, much like the composer himself, were a (i)_____ affair. Fits of passion would, without warning, give way to sudden idylls, as though the composer had been trying to (ii)_____ his inner conflicts. Only in his later works, which are far more abstract, does he eschew trying to capture his inner states.
Blank(i) | Blank(ii) |
---|---|
A mercurial | D exorcise |
B rambling | E foreshadow |
C torrid | F mirror |
